#bb68f5 Color Information
In a RGB color space, hex #bb68f5 is composed of 73.3% red, 40.8% green and 96.1% blue. Whereas in a CMYK color space, it is composed of 23.7% cyan, 57.6% magenta, 0% yellow and 3.9% black. It has a hue angle of 275.3 degrees, a saturation of 87.6% and a lightness of 68.4%. #bb68f5 color hex could be obtained by blending #ffd0ff with #7700eb. Closest websafe color is: #cc66ff.

#bb68f5 Color Conversion
The hexadecimal color #bb68f5 has RGB values of R:187, G:104, B:245 and CMYK values of C:0.24, M:0.58, Y:0, K:0.04. Its decimal value is 12282101.

Shades and Tints of #bb68f5
A shade is achieved by adding black to any pure hue, while a tint is created by mixing white to any pure color. In this example, #09010f is the darkest color, while #fdfbff is the lightest one.

Tones of #bb68f5
A tone is produced by adding gray to any pure hue. In this case, #afacb1 is the less saturated color, while #bc62fb is the most saturated one.
